Subject[GIT PULL] x86/apic fix
Linus,

Please pull the latest x86-apic-for-linus git tree from:

git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/tip/tip.git x86-apic-for-linus

# HEAD: d0b7788804482b2689946cd8d910ac3e03126c8d x86/apic/uv: Avoid unused variable warning

A single commit that simplifies the code and gets rid of a compiler
warning.

Thanks,

Ingo

------------------>
Arnd Bergmann (1):
x86/apic/uv: Avoid unused variable warning


arch/x86/kernel/apic/x2apic_uv_x.c | 43 ++++++--------------------------------
1 file changed, 6 insertions(+), 37 deletions(-)
